The twin Villages of Barford St John and
Barford St Michael are opposite one another
across the shallow valley of the River Swere.
The village of Barford St Michael has a community feel about it, it has a thriving village hall with various activities taking place throughout the year. Each month there is the Village Market selling local produce which brings the community together. The nearby villages of Deddington and Bloxham also offer a good range of facilities.
